Poets not only rely on rhyming when writing poetry, but they also rely on structure, or rhyme scheme, to help them build or 'sculpt' their works on paper. Let's explore what rhyme schemes are and then take a closer look at a few specific types of rhyme schemes: rhyming couplets, alternate rhymes, and the sonnet.

Famed poet and humorist Dixon Lanier Merritt's limerick " A Wonderful … Webb7 apr. 2024 · Rhyming poems are poems that feature rhyming words at the end of certain verses. Unlike free verse poetry, rhyming poems must contain words that sound alike. Generally, rhyming poetry follows some sort of set pattern, meaning the writer intends for certain lines to rhyme with one another. WebbBy playing with the short texts of rhymes, children explore the mechanics of the English language. They find out how language works and become familiar with the relationship between the 44 sounds of English and the 26 alphabet letters – information which helps them when they begin reading to decode the sounds that make up words.
